System For Cab Comparison, Booking, And Bargaining

Abstract: “SYSTEM FOR CAB COMPARISON, BOOKING, AND BARGAINING” The system for cab comparison, booking, and bargaining, includes a user-friendly mobile application that allows customers to access multiple cab service providers' 5 information on a single platform, an integrated fare comparison feature that enables customers to compare prices, estimated pick-up times, and service ratings of different cab service providers, a centralized booking system that facilitates swift and seamless ride bookings for customers based on their preferences and selected cab options, a fare negotiation module that permits customers to engage in fare 10 bargaining with cab drivers within predefined limits, ensuring a fair and transparent negotiation process, a real-time data processing and GPS tracking to provide accurate and up-to-date information on cab availability and location, a secure payment gateways for secure and hassle-free transactions between customers and cab service providers, a user account management system that allows customers to 15 create and manage their profiles, preferences, and payment details for streamlined booking processes, a feedback mechanism for customers to rate and review cab service providers, enhancing transparency and service quality, and an analytics and reporting module for cab service providers to monitor demand patterns, customer feedback, and service performance, aiding in service improvement.

[0003] The transportation industry has undergone a significant transformation
in recent years with the advent of ride-hailing services and mobile applications.
Traditional taxi services have faced tough competition from modern ride-hailing
15 platforms like Uber, Ola, Lyft, and others. These ride-hailing services have
revolutionized the way people commute, providing convenient and efficient
transportation solutions with just a few taps on a smartphone.
[0004] While ride-hailing services have brought numerous benefits, such as
ease of booking, GPS tracking, and cashless payments, they have also presented
20 certain challenges and limitations. One of the primary concerns for customers is the
lack of transparency in fare pricing and the absence of a platform that allows them
to compare prices and choose the most cost-effective option.
[0005] Existing ride-hailing applications require customers to download
separate apps for each cab service provider, leading to device clutter and reduced
25 user convenience. This fragmented approach also hampers the ability of customers
to make informed decisions about the best available option, leading to potential
overspending on rides.
[0006] Furthermore, another pain point for customers is the inability to3
negotiate fares with cab drivers. The fixed pricing model in most ride-hailing apps
leaves customers with little room for bargaining, resulting in a sense of
dissatisfaction and a missed opportunity to secure better deals.
[0007] In light of these challenges and shortcomings, there is a growing need
5 for a comprehensive platform that addresses the concerns of both customers and
cab service providers. A system that enables cab fare comparison, seamless
booking, and fare negotiation would not only enhance customer satisfaction but also
foster healthy competition among cab companies, driving them to improve their
services.
